#f9e174 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f9e174 is composed of 97.6% red, 88.2%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.6%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 49.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 71.6%. #f9e174 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#f3c300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#f9e174

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0900 is the darkest color, while #fffd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9e174

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cbab1 is the less saturated color, while #ffe56e is the most saturated one.
